Summary

Document the new --include-spaces and --exclude-spaces flags on lightdash validate in the CLI reference.

Changes

  • Add both flags to the lightdash validate options list, noting they're mutually exclusive and that space matching cascades into sub-spaces.
  • Call out the key behaviors: fail-fast on unknown slugs, invisible spaces can't be matched, table errors are project-level (use --only tables), and hidden errors show a count but don't affect the exit code.
  • Add two example invocations covering the include and exclude flows.

Context

Follows lightdash/lightdash#25437, which lets CI validate production content without failing on errors in archive or development spaces.
